At Realistic Roots Nutrition Counseling, our team of Dietitians each brings a minimum of seven years of experience in the field of nutrition and a shared commitment to a non-diet, client-centered approach.

Each Dietitian on our team offers unique areas of expertise to best serve the individuals and populations they work with most effectively.

MALORIE SWEENEY

Malorie has been a clinician since 2012 and is a Certified Eating Disorder Specialist and Supervisor. She holds a Master’s degree in Nutrition and a Bachelor’s degree in Neuroscience and Behavioral Studies, and has worked across all levels of eating disorder treatment.

Known for her warm yet firm approach, she supports clients with both compassion and accountability—challenging and inspiring them as they work toward lasting change. She is also a strong advocate for body and size inclusivity and helps clients build trust in themselves and their bodies

EMILY HEINBACH

Emily has been a Registered Dietitian since 2019 and has experience working in eating disorder treatment. She is a Certified Breastfeeding Specialist and works especially well with adolescents and young adults, creating a space where clients feel understood and supported.

Emily is well-versed in working with vegetarian and vegan clients and has a true gift for connecting with people and individualizing care. She practices from a non-diet, weight-inclusive approach and is lovingly known on our team as the “astrology queen.” Emily lives in Philadelphia, PA, and brings curiosity, warmth, and insight into her work with clients.

meet our dietitian

AMRIE WEISS

Amrie has been a clinician since 2012 and brings a thoughtful, compassionate approach to working with medically complex clients. She has extensive experience supporting individuals with gastrointestinal conditions, autoimmune diseases, allergies, and cancer, and she is especially passionate about helping people navigate challenging medical diagnoses with confidence and care.

Amrie is also well versed in eating disorder treatment and body image work, allowing her to support the whole person—not just the diagnosis. She practices from a weight-inclusive, gender-affirming, and culturally sensitive lens, creating a safe and supportive space for clients of all backgrounds.

meet our dietitian

PAM JOHNSON

Pam has been a Registered Dietitian since 2016 and has experience working at all levels of care for eating disorder treatment. She supports clients with a wide range of medical nutrition needs and enjoys working with people across the lifespan—from infants to older adults.

Pam holds her Lactation Education Counselor certificate and is also a yoga instructor, bringing a holistic, grounded perspective into her work. Known for her warm and compassionate style, she is also skilled at gently challenging clients to support meaningful progress. And if you see her in the office, you may even get to meet her pup, Ollie!

meet our dietitian

SARAH SCHULTZ

Sarah has been a Registered Dietitian since 2016 and is a Certified Nutrition Support Clinician with extensive experience working in acute care settings. She especially enjoys supporting older adults and individuals with complex medical needs, helping them navigate nutrition with confidence and care.

Sarah is passionate about healthy aging, longevity, and improving healthspan, and she loves working with women who are navigating menopause and nutrition-related changes. Her approach is thoughtful, practical, and rooted in meeting clients where they are while challenging her clients to meet their goals.

meet our dietitian

LEAH MORGAN

Leah has been a Dietitian since 2009 and is a Certified Eating Disorder Specialist as well as a Licensed BE Body Positive Facilitator. She has extensive experience in eating disorder treatment and supervising other dietitians, using evidence-based nutrition therapy informed by Intuitive Eating and Health at Every Size principles.

Known for her empathy, curiosity, and well-timed humor, Leah fosters trust and connection with her clients. She works with people of all ages and conditions, creating a collaborative, supportive therapeutic environment where clients feel seen, respected, and empowered.
